Automotive Legal Services

Rosen Law Firm is continuing its investigation into America s Car-Mart for allegedly issuing materially misleading business information to the investing public. This investigation stems from America s Car-Mart's first-quarter results reported on September 4, 2025, which showed a loss of 69 cents per share, significantly worse than the 15 cents per share loss in the prior year. Following the publication of an article by Benzinga detailing these results, America s Car-Mart's stock plunged by 18.2%. Rosen Law Firm is preparing a class action lawsuit to recover investor losses, encouraging affected shareholders to join the prospective action.
